What Is Full-Arch Substitute?



Full-arch replacement is a dental treatment designed to bring back a whole arch of missing out on teeth, usually in the upper or reduced jaw. This process entails using oral implants or a dealt with prosthesis, which can substantially boost your dental function and visual look.

If you're missing out on most or every one of your teeth, this option could be suitable for you, as it supplies a secure and long lasting service.

During the treatment, your dental professional will certainly analyze your jawbone's health and framework. If essential, they'll execute bone implanting to make certain there suffices assistance for the implants.

Hereafter, they'll put the implants right into the jawbone, serving as roots for your brand-new teeth. You'll after that wait for the implants to integrate with the bone, a process referred to as osseointegration, which can take several months.

As soon as healing is complete, your dentist will attach the personalized prosthetic teeth to the implants. This strategy not just recovers your smile but additionally aids maintain your jawbone's stability.

Eventually, full-arch replacement supplies a comprehensive remedy for those dealing with considerable tooth loss, supplying both useful and esthetic benefits.

Risks of Full-Arch Replacement



While the benefits of full-arch replacements are compelling, it is necessary to weigh the risks that include the treatment. One considerable threat is the possibility for infection. After surgery, there's always an opportunity that germs can go into the surgical website, bring about difficulties.

You might additionally experience bleeding, which, while normally convenient, can occasionally need further intervention.

One more problem is nerve damages. During the treatment, neighboring nerves can be influenced, leading to numbness or discomfort. This might solve over time, yet in some cases, it can cause long-term concerns.



In addition, you may encounter complications related to the implants themselves. These can include loosening, fracture, or failing of the prosthetic, requiring extra surgeries.
